Ingredients Breakdown

For those ready to embark on this baking adventure, understanding each ingredient’s role in the Zesty Key Lime Coconut Bliss Cookies is essential. Here’s a breakdown of the key ingredients that come together to create this tropical delight:

Unsalted Butter: Butter is a crucial ingredient in any cookie recipe, providing the necessary fat for a rich, tender texture. Using unsalted butter allows for better control over the overall saltiness of the cookies, ensuring that the other flavors shine.

Granulated and Brown Sugar: This dynamic duo of sugars brings both sweetness and moisture to the cookies. Granulated sugar helps create a crisp exterior, while brown sugar contributes to a chewy texture and a deeper flavor due to its molasses content.

Key Limes: The star ingredient of this recipe, key limes provide the essential tartness that defines the flavor profile of the cookies. Their juice and zest will infuse the dough with a refreshing zing that balances the sweetness of the other components.

Eggs: Eggs serve as a binding agent, helping to hold the cookie dough together while adding moisture. They also contribute to the cookies’ overall structure, ensuring they bake up beautifully.

All-Purpose Flour: Flour is the backbone of any cookie, providing structure and stability. It allows the cookies to rise and hold their shape while baking.

Baking Soda: As a leavening agent, baking soda helps the cookies rise, creating a light and airy texture. It works in tandem with the acidic key lime juice to produce the perfect cookie consistency.

Sea Salt: A pinch of sea salt enhances the flavors of the ingredients, balancing the sweetness and amplifying the overall taste of the cookies.

Sweetened Shredded Coconut: Coconut adds a delightful chewiness and an unmistakable tropical flair. The sweetened variety complements the tartness of the key lime, making every bite a blissful experience.

White Chocolate Chips: These creamy morsels introduce an additional layer of sweetness that beautifully contrasts with the tart key lime. Their smooth texture melts into the cookie, elevating the overall flavor profile.

Preparation Steps Explained

Now that we have a comprehensive understanding of the ingredients, let’s dive into the preparation steps for creating these Zesty Key Lime Coconut Bliss Cookies. Follow these detailed instructions to ensure your cookies turn out perfectly every time:

1.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is crucial as it ensures that your cookies bake evenly and achieve that golden-brown color we all love.

2. Prepare the Baking Sheet: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at. This will prevent the cookies from sticking and make cleanup a breeze.

3. Cream the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of unsalted butter (softened at room temperature) with 1/2 cup of granulated sugar and 1/2 cup of brown sugar. Using an electric mixer, cream the ingredients together on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y. This process typically takes about 2-3 minutes. Creaming incorporates air into the mixture, which helps the cookies rise.

4. Add the Eggs and Lime: Once the butter and sugars are well combined, add 2 large e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Next, incorporate the zest of 2 key limes and the juice of those same limes (approximately 1/4 cup). The key lime juice will add moisture and acidity, enhancing the flavor of the cookies.

5.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together 2 cups of all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on of baking soda, and 1/2 teaspoon of sea salt. This step ensures that the leavening agent and salt are evenly distributed throughout the flour before adding it to the wet ingredients.

6. Mix Dry Ingredients into Wet: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can lead to tough cookies. The dough should be soft and slightly sticky.

7. Fold in Coconut and White Chocolate: Gently fold in 1 cup of sweetened shredded coconut and 1 cup of white chocolate chips with a spatula or wooden spoon. This will ensure that the coconut and chocolate are evenly distributed throughout the dough, creating a deliciously balanced cookie.

Baking the Cookies to Perfection

Baking cookies is both an art and a science. Understanding the role of temperature and time is essential for achieving the ideal texture in Zesty Key Lime Coconut Bliss Cookies. When you place the cookies in a preheated oven, the heat initiates a series of chemical reactions that transform the dough into a soft, chewy cookie. The key is to find the perfect balance: too little time, and your cookies will be doughy; too much, and they’ll turn hard, losing that desirable chewy texture.

The Science of Baking

The temperature of your oven plays a crucial role in how cookies will rise and spread. If your oven is too hot, the cookies may spread too quickly, resulting in thin, crispy edges with a raw center. Conversely, if the oven temperature is too low, the cookies might not spread at all, leading to a cake-like texture rather than the desired chewy one. For our Zesty Key Lime Coconut Bliss Cookies, a temperature of 350°F (175°C) is ideal, providing a gentle bake that allows the cookies to rise beautifully while maintaining a soft center.

Tips for Identifying When Cookies are Perfectly Baked

As the cookies bake, keep an eye on them. The visual cues are often the best indicators of doneness. Look for a slight golden edge and a puffed center that has just started to set. The cookies will continue to bake on the baking sheet after being removed from the oven due to residual heat, so it’s essential to take them out just before they look fully baked. A good rule of thumb is to let them rest on the baking sheet for about five minutes before transferring them to a cooling rack. This will ensure that the edges firm up while the centers remain delightfully soft.

Cooling Time and Its Impact on Final Texture

Patience is key in baking. After removing the cookies from the oven, allow them to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es. This cooling time is crucial as it affects the final texture of the cookies. If you transfer them to a cooling rack too soon, they might break apart. Once they have set slightly, moving them to a wire rack allows for proper air circulation and cooling, preventing sogginess. After about 15-20 minutes, they will be ready for indulgence.

Key Lime Coconut White Chocolate Chip Cookies

Ingredients
  

1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ter, softened

1 cup granulated sugar

1/2 cup brown sugar, packed

2 large eggs

Zest of 2 key limes

2 tablespoons key lime juice

1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ract

2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our

1 teaspoon baking soda

1/2 teaspoon sea salt

1 cup sweetened shredded coconut

1 cup white chocolate chips

Instructions
 

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line baking sheets with parchment paper.

    Cream the Butters and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.

      Add Eggs and Flavorings: Beat in the eggs one at a time, ensuring they are well incorporated. Add the key lime zest, key lime juice, and vanilla extract, mixing until combined.

        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, and sea salt.

          Mix Dry with Wet: Gradually add the dry mixture to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.

            Fold in Coconut and Chips: Gently fold in the shredded coconut and white chocolate chips until evenly distributed throughout the dough.

              Scoop the Dough: Using a cookie scoop or tablespoon, drop rounded balls of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, spacing them about 2 inches apart.

                Bake the Cookies: Bake in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es or until the edges are lightly golden. The centers may appear slightly underbaked; they will firm up while cooling.

                  Cool and Enjoy: Remove the cookies from the oven and allow them to cool on the baking sheet for about 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

                    Serve and Savor: Serve the cookies warm or at room temperature, and enjoy the tropical flavors of key lime, coconut, and sweet white chocolate!

                      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 minutes | 30 minutes | 24 cookies
